The first two Dragonflight talent tree previews are out for
Death Knight
and
Druid
.
In this week's GG WoW video Dratnos and Tettles take a quick look at the newly revealed Talent Trees and deliver some first impressions. The way the trees generally appear to function is that the top half or so contain mostly current abilities and passives that we get for free plus some existing talents, while the bottom half contain some very exciting effects, many of which were previously seen in systems like Artifact Weapons, Azerite Armor, Torghast Powers, Set Bonuses, and Conduits. The generic class tree also offers several effects that aren't new to one of the specs but are new to the others, such as
Wille der Nekropole
for DPS DKs.
As long as it doesn't feel like most or all points need to be spent to bring us back to the kit that we have now, this system is pretty exciting, as it promises some exciting choices and potentially the ability to stack multiple power effects that we've never been able to play with at the same time before.
One other revelation from the preview was the return of
Mark of the Wild
, an iconic Druid raid buff from early in the game's history. Is the addition of more such raid buffs a good or bad thing? Should everyone have one? Or does it just not matter since Druids are so ubiquitious that there's always one in almost every raid anyway?
